comment ajouter un code javascript personnalisé pour google sites?
Comment puis-je obtenir la possibilité d'ajouter/modifier le JS sur un google sites site? De cette façon, je veux utiliser jQuery et jQuery UI pour manipuler l'apparence du site.
Pour être clair, je ne parle pas de tous les sites google, juste le fait de créer votre propre système de google a mis à la, baptisé "Google Sites" -> https://sites.google.com/.
Sur le howto page, il y a ceci:
Fonctionnalités non prises en charge
Le code HTML de la Boîte de l'outil actuellement ne prend pas en charge les fonctionnalités suivantes:
iframes code JavaScript ne peut pas créer un script, une image ou un lien tags
Document/fenêtre onload et onready fonctions. Vous pouvez placer n'importe
JavaScript à la fin du code qui doit se charger après le document
les charges.
Cela signifie HTML outil ne permet pas de créer des tags? même s'ils sont dans la démo ci-dessus?
eh bien, je veux utiliser google sites, mais beaucoup d'options de style et sont incapables de modifier les paramètres d'habitude, alors j'ai pensé que si je pouvais ex exécuter un bloc de JS sur la page, j'ai pu mettre dans mon propre jQuery et changer ce que je voulais changer.
Vous êtes à la recherche pour GreaseMonkey? Google Chrome dispose d'un support intégré pour GreaseMonkey. Jetez un oeil à userscripts.org pour des exemples de ce que vous pouvez faire.
Je ne comprends toujours pas, pourquoi voulez-vous changer de site google, comme gmail par exemple.
non... les sites google -> sites.google.com
OriginalL'auteur jeffery_the_wind | 2012-06-03
Vous devez vous connecter pour publier un commentaire.
Google Sites permet explique comment ajouter votre propre code HTML/CSS/JS de contenu:
Il note que "le code d'une HTML de la boîte ne peut pas interagir avec, ou consultez le code de l'extérieur de l'HTML de la boîte, y compris d'autres HTML boîtes" -- sans doute, chaque "HTML" de la boîte est un séparément bac à sable élément iframe. En tant que tel, votre capacité à utiliser JS pour "manipuler l'apparence du site" va être assez limité.
Comme je l'ai indiqué, les capacités de JS cours d'exécution dans les Sites Google sandbox sont limités. Selon ce que vous voulez faire, vous peut ou peut ne pas être en mesure de le faire. (En particulier, si vous essayez de modifier le contenu de la page qui ne fait pas partie du code HTML de zone, vous êtes hors de la chance.)
j'ai essayé de mettre cela dans le code HTML, et pas de boîte d'alerte a montré :
<script type="text/javascript"> alert('something'); </script>
Je vois, ouais alors ça ne marcherait pas. Je veux changer la hauteur de ther nav-bar, de la localisation et de la taille des onglets de navigation... etc.
HTML boîte n'a pas le rendu avec un <script> tag.
OriginalL'auteur duskwuff
Une autre alternative est d'écrire votre propre Gadget
"Gadgets sont de petites applications web qui peuvent être ajoutés à des pages web. Les Gadgets sont des fichiers XML qui enveloppez le HTML et le JavaScript" comme l'explique Google sur des Sites de Gourou qui va par le nom Mori.
https://sites.google.com/site/mori79/html-gadgets
Vous pouvez également trouver plus d'informations dans les Développeurs de Google site:
https://developers.google.com/google-apps/sites/gadgets/site_gadgets?hl=en
Espère que cela aide.
OriginalL'auteur Hugo O.
Google Site a une bonne documentation, et vous ne pouvez pas utiliser le code JavaScript à l'encontre de leurs programme politique.
Veuillez lire la documentation, il répertorie les détails des étapes d'insertion personnalisé CSS, le JavaScript et le général HTML.
est une politique générale pour l'hébergement de Google Sites et Google Docs. Si vous jetez un oeil à la documentation de Google Site, ils ont expressément un lien vers cette politique. Donc, l'ensemble de votre contenu, javascript, css, images devraient suivre la même politique. "L'alerte" ne fonctionne pas tout simplement parce que c'est contre la politique. Je n'ai intentionnellement lien vers leur doc au lieu de copier les étapes, parce que leur documentation pourrait changer au fil du temps, votre copié le contenu ne sera pas en mesure de le tenir à jour. Ce n'est PAS hors de propos. Veuillez donc lire attentivement avant de notation.
Il est possible que nous sommes en train de voir les différentes versions de la page de politiques. La version que je vais voir ne mentionne pas le JavaScript n'importe où.
Ce lien est tout simplement de parler de la violence, les discours de haine, la sécurité des enfants, etc. Absolument rien à voir avec le Javascript.
OriginalL'auteur activars